2. Steam condensation in a water pool and its effect on thermal stratification and mixing
Abstract : The Pressure Suppression Pool (PSP) of a Boiling Water Reactor (BWR) is a large heat sink designed to limit the containment pressure by condensing steam released from the primary coolant system. The development of thermal stratification is a safety concern since it leads to higher containment pressures than in completely mixed conditions, and can affect the performance of systems such as the emergency core cooling and containment spray, which the use PSP as a source of water. 4. On the Foundations of Practical Language-Based Security
Abstract : Language-based information flow control (IFC) promises to provide programming languages and tools that make it easy for developers to write secure code. Traditionally, research in this field aims to build a variant on a programming language or system that lets developers write code that gives them strong guarantees beyond the potential memory- and type-safety guarantees of modern languages.
